Let's start with Particular person Retirement Accounts (IRAs). You've two key styles: Roth IRA and Classic IRA. A Roth IRA gives tax-no cost growth and tax-no cost withdrawals in retirement, making it a powerful preference in the event you foresee currently being in the next tax bracket later. Conversely, a Traditional IRA provides tax-deductible contributions and taxes are deferred until eventually you withdraw money during retirement, which may very well be helpful if you expect being within a reduced tax bracket post-retirement.

Future, take into account your 401(k) alternatives, particularly if your employer offers a matching contribution. This tends to significantly boost your price savings. Pay attention for the number of investment decision selections within just your 401(k), which include focus on day funds, which mechanically modify the asset mix as you around retirement age.

Never ignore Health and fitness Price savings Accounts (HSAs) In case you have a large-deductible overall health approach. HSAs supply triple tax pros: tax-deductible contributions, tax-free development, and tax-totally free withdrawals for qualified healthcare bills. In retirement, you can use these resources for general fees without penalty, although standard profits taxes implement.

Another element of risk administration in retirement setting up is recognizing the influence of sequence of returns possibility. This possibility happens when the market experiences significant downturns equally as you begin to withdraw resources in retirement. Destructive returns early in retirement can deplete your portfolio extra speedily than if exactly the same returns occurred later on. To manage this, you would possibly take into consideration techniques like maintaining a dollars reserve or structuring withdrawals much more strategically.
